Amber Watch from Oban recently attended the water safety spring meeting in the town. This was organised by @AdventureOban, partnered by @ObanRNLI and Oban Sailing Club, and offered local guidance and advice regarding safe and sensible approaches to our local waterways.

Way back at the start of the year, one of the first things Adventure Oban got stuck into was leading a volunteer rota to keep the Ganavan toilets open throughout the winter.

We got soaked, we got muddy - but we got our hoover! Today’s One Million Miles Beach Clean managed to pick up some biggies that had become part of the scenery - tyres, traffic cones and even a hoover! Thanks to those that came out and @argyllandbute for picking up the waste!

Earlier in the summer, Faraid Winterton took home the @Argyll_ButeTSI award for Young Sports Leader of the Year. Faraid was nominated for her enthusiastic commitment to our #onemillionmiles project, inspiring schools across the area to get involved. Well done Faraid!

Huge thanks to @scotseafarms for their donation of 35 tow floats to the Adventure Library. Together we’re also working with the @RNLI@ObanRNLI and @argyllandbute on a wider water safety programme to support all water users in the area - keep an eye out for more info coming soon.
